Judge Calabrese Sat on Ohio Supreme Court
According to a recent Ohio Supreme Court Press Release, Judge Anthony O. Calabrese, Jr. of our local Eighth District Court of Appeals, recently sat as a visiting judge on the Supreme Court of Ohio in the case of State of Ohio v. Christopher Mays, (No. 2007-1302), which involved a driver who was stopped when he went right of the road edge line. Mays' counsel challenged the stop as in conflict with a decision of the Third District Court of Appeals in State v. Phillips (Case No. 8-04-25). Reports indicate that Judge Calabrese was both honored and "humbled" by his appointment. The video of the oral argument in Mays can be found at the Supreme Court's website. The last time Judge Calabrese served as a visiting Judge at the Supreme Court was November of 2006.
